Stepping into the broad spectrum of smoking paraphernalia, one may wonder, “what is a bubbler?” A bubbler is a type of water pipe, a hybrid between a traditional pipe and the more complex bongs. It’s compact like a pipe, yet includes the water chamber of a bong, contributing to a smoother smoke filtration. Now, let’s plunge deeper into exploring the advantages and proper usage of bubblers.

How to Use a Bubbler?
So, how exactly does one use a bubbler? It’s simple once you get the hang of it. Here’s a quick run-down:
- Fill the bubbler with enough water to create bubbles, but not so much that it splashes into the tube.
- Grind your preferred herbs finely and pack them into the bowl, but not so tight that it impedes airflow.
- Hold the bubbler in a way that lets you cover the carb (small hole on the side) with your finger.
- While covering the carb, light the bowl and inhale slowly to draw smoke into the chamber.
- Release your finger from the carb and inhale the smoke from the chamber.

Why Do Bubblers Get You Higher?
An intriguing question often raised is, why do bubblers get you higher? The answer lies in their water filtration system. The water cools down the smoke, making it smoother and easier to inhale deeply. This means you’re more likely to absorb more of the substance, resulting in a potentially stronger effect. However, this also depends on other factors such as the type and quantity of the substance used.
Do You Put Water in Hammer Bubblers?
Yes, you do put water in hammer bubblers. The design of a hammer bubbler includes a flat base, allowing it to stand upright, much like a hammer. The water chamber sits on this base, and the stem and bowl extend from the top. To use a hammer bubbler, you fill the base with water, ensuring the bottom of the stem is submerged. This allows for the filtration and cooling of the smoke, providing a smoother hit.
